懒驴
首页
随笔录
时间轴
日志
相册
友情链接
分类
微服务 (2)
负载均衡 (5)
Spring Cloud (13)
分布式 (20)
直 播 (3)
Java相关 (37)
Web前端 (2)
数据库 (4)
开发技术 (58)
随笔录 (20)
全部分类 ( 70 )
查询
当前位于"Java相关"分类下
抽奖的加权算法--按照权重概率中奖
临近春节了,各大平台也好还是各个公司,大大小小都会搞一些抽奖之类的活动,那么随之而来的也涉及到开发各种各样的抽奖系统,有公平公正公开的,全随机抽奖,也有按照权重比例的来抽奖的。
2022年01月12日
293次浏览
SpringBoot实现的图片预览地址
有时候项目会遇到需要后端直接提供一个请求地址,浏览器打开直接就是显示图片,而非下载,SpringBoot项目中的具体实现代码如下:import javax.servlet.ServletOutputStream;import javax.servlet.http.HttpServletRequest
Java
SpringBoot
2021年12月21日
440次浏览
DM8--SpringBoot整合达梦数据库
在上一篇 DM8--达梦数据库(安装步骤) 中已经介绍了数据库DM8的安装步骤,接下来将主要介绍在项目中如何连接使用达梦数据库,在这里主要讲在SpringBoot项目中对达梦数据库的整合。
Java
DM8
SpringBoot
2021年12月15日
772次浏览
分布式服务框架协议
在分布式服务框架中,服务之间通过RPC技术进行通信,而RPC通常采用二进制私有协议。因为公有协议(HTTP、WebService)在性能方面没有私有协议好,所以很多都采用自研的私有协议或者主流的私有协议作为服务之间的通信协议。主流公有协议目前主流的公有协议有HTTP、SOAP等。HTTPHTTP是一
Spring Cloud
RPC
2021年12月13日
399次浏览
Java的一些对时间操作的工具类
分享一下本人在学习中积累的一些对时间操作的方法,Java代码如下:
Java
2021年12月10日
333次浏览
Java实现对多文件压缩程zip文件操作的工具类
直接上代码:import java.io.*;import java.util.List;import java.util.zip.ZipEntry;import java.util.zip.ZipOutputStream;/*** * Zip压缩文件操作工具类 */public class Zip
Java
zip
2021年12月10日
321次浏览
实现多文件同时下载,多文件打包zip下载(SpringBoot)
在项目开发中,难免会遇到对文件的下载功能,也往往会遇到同时对多个文件一起下载的问题,下面就来介绍对多文件下载是的一种方法。那么对多文件下载时,我们可以将需要下载的多个文件先压缩成一个zip临时文件,然后下载该zip文件,最后删除zip文件。Java实现代码如下。编写ZipOutTools.java
Java
zip
SpringBoot
2021年12月10日
305次浏览
Netty框架(一)
Netty是一款异步的事件驱动的网络应用程序框架,支持快速开发可维护、高性能且面向协议的服务器和客户端。Netty主要是对Java的NIO包进行的封装。Netty的特性总结分类特性设计统一的API,支持多种传输类型,阻塞的和非阻塞的简单而强大的线程模型真正的无连接数据报套接字支持链接逻辑组件以支持复
Java
Spring Cloud
Netty
2021年12月07日
300次浏览
(六)NIO编程--2篇
Java NIO和IO的主要区别:1.面向流与面向缓冲Java NIO和IO之间最大的区别是,IO是面向流的,NIO是面向缓冲区的。Java IO面向流意味着每次从流中读一个或多个字节,直接读取所有字节,它们没有被缓存在任何地方。此外,Java IO不能前后移动流中的数据。如果需要前后移动从流中读取
2021年12月07日
273次浏览
(六)NIO编程--1篇
首先先抛出一个问题:少量的线程如何同时为大量连接服务呢?答案就是:就绪选择。这就好比到餐厅吃饭,每来一桌客人,就有一个服务员专门服务,从你进餐厅到最后结账走人。这种方式的好处就是服务质量好,一对一的VIP服务,可是缺点也很明显,成本高。如果餐厅生意好,同时来100桌客人,那么就需要100个服务员了,
Java
Spring Cloud
RPC
2021年12月06日
271次浏览
«
1
2
(current)
3
»
个人信息
懒驴
北京 中关村
文章数量
70
分类数量
10
标签数量
36
与各位驴友相互学习、相互交流。
所有标签
TCP/IP
1
VMware
1
Maven
1
VUE
1
AES
1
RSA
2
idea
1
UDP
1
DES
2
TCP
1
麒麟V10
5
RabbitMQ
3
CSS
1
Python
1
DM8
5
windows
1
zip
2
Netty
1
RPC
14
Spring Cloud
14
mybatis-plus
3
JWT
1
RFID
1
SpringBoot
8
Linux
8
JDK
3
RTSP
2
JavaCV
3
Nginx
2
FFmpeg
0
UWB
1
Redis
3
JavaScript
2
HTML
2
MySQL
1
Java
30
所有标签
70